Position Summary

The Senior Warehouse Associate (SWA) must be a team oriented individual capable of working in a fast paced, dynamic environment. A SWA's duties include being able to independently work all aspects/colors of the factory equipment to sort products efficiently. The SWA will be responsible for the opening and/or closing of the warehouse. As well as assisting the Donated Goods Manager with the daily needs of the warehouse.

Essential Functions

  • Use forklift to transport bales and capsacks to their correct locations in the warehouse and stack them appropriately
  • Use a forklift to remove pallets from the back of the trucks during the unloading process.
  • Use forklift to transport pallets and gayloads to correct location in the warehouse and stack them appropriately
  • Be able to move the 20’ box trucks to the dock for unloading and return the truck to the lot when unloaded.
  • Prepare daily plan based on the Direction from Donated Goods Manager
  • Hold the morning meeting.
  • Responsible for filing end of day reports.
  • Responsible for closing the warehouse for the day.
  • Properly unloading donations from multiple trucks per day.
  • Create bales throughout the day.
  • Assist in maintaining warehouse inventory and organizing in a manner that best assists the overall operation.
  • Work effectively with customer service representatives, leadership, and donors in a team environment.
  • Maintain a customer-focused perspective in all activities initiated to ensure that company needs are successfully met.
